City of Carmi City Council met April 17.

Here is the minutes provided by the Council:

A public hearing was held Tuesday, April 17, 2018, at 5:15 p.m. in the Council Room of the Municipal Building at 225 East Main Street for the purpose of rezoning 134 Fair Street. Troy Dietz from Martin and Bayley was present. Mr. Dietz stated the 134 Fair Street location would be used as an additional parking lot for the Huck’s Convenience Store.

The Carmi City Council then met at 5:30 p.m. following the public hearing. The meeting was called to order.

Mayor Pollard asked Alderman Winkleman to give the invocation followed by the Pledge of Allegiance.

Mayor Pollard presided with the following Aldermen present: Mark W. Blake, Sheila Jo Headlee, Doug Hays, Mike Knight, Tracy Nelson, Steve Winkleman, Lance Yearby, and Jeremy Courson.

Minutes from the April 3, 2018, council meeting were presented. Motion was made by Alderman Headlee and seconded by Alderman Winkleman to approve the minutes as presented.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Mayor Pollard asked the council to approve the March 2018 Financial Reports for the City of Carmi and Light & Water Departments. Motion was made by Alderman Headlee and seconded by Alderman Winkleman to approve the March 2018 Financial Reports for the City of Carmi and Light & Water Departments.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Mayor Pollard asked the council to authorize and approve the April 2018 vendor invoices for the City of Carmi and Light & Water Departments. Alderman Winkleman made a motion to approve the April 2018 vendor invoices for the City of Carmi and the Light & Water Departments. Alderman Courson seconded the motion.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Mayor Pollard stated Brian Allen was to address the council regarding Pre-Disaster Planning offered by Slay’s Restoration of Carmi, but Mr. Allen had called earlier in the day and was ill. He will address the council at a later date.

Mayor Pollard asked the council to approve Resolution No. 04.17.18.; A resolution renewing the employee’s safety incentive program for the period of April 1, 2018, to March 31, 2019. Alderman Blake made a motion to approve Resolution No. 04.17.18; A resolution renewing the employee’s safety incentive program for the period of April 1, 2018, to March 31, 2019. Alderman Courson seconded the motion.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Mayor Pollard presented ordinance No. 1543, An ordinance amending zoning ordinance #778 for the City of Carmi property at 134 Fair Street, PIN # 1314 457007 owned by Martin and Bayley Huck’s Convenience Store. Alderman Headlee made a motion to approve ordinance

No. 1543, an ordinance amending zoning ordinance #778 for the City of Carmi property at 134 Fair Street, PIN # 1314 457007 owned by Martin and Bayley Huck’s Convenience Store. Alderman Nelson seconded the motion.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Mayor Pollard asked the council to consider the reappointment of Braden Willis, III, to the Police Commission for a three (3) year term effective January 1, 2018, to December 31, 2020. Alderman Hays made a motion to reappointment Braden Willis, III, to the Police Commission for a three (3) year term effective January 1, 2018, to December 31, 2020. Alderman Blake seconded the motion. The motion carried on roll call by each Alderman present answering “yes.”

Reports and/or updates from Mayor Pollard

Mayor Pollard would like to invite the public to the second annual White County CEO Trade Show at Rice Motor Company on April 23, 2018, from 5: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. The CEO students will have their business products available for purchase.

The American Red Cross will be holding a blood drive at the First Christian Church Fellowship Hall in Carmi on Tuesday, April 24, 2018, from 2: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. The public is invited to help the American Red Cross save lives.

Opening Day at Bradshaw Park will be held on Saturday, April 28, 2017, with the ceremony beginning at 11:00 a.m. Please come out and support the youth of our community.

Once again, I would like to remind everyone there is an ordinance against blowing grass and debris into the streets and you could be ticketed for this.

Mayor Pollard stated Chief Jason Carter was unable to be at the meeting tonight but wanted it reported that the Carmi White County School System did approve hiring of a School Resource Officer (SRO) at Monday’s meeting.

Reports from Standing Committees

Alderman Blake reported he had been out to Burrell Campground and it looks very nice with all the tree removals and upgrades to the shower house.

At 5:40 p.m. the council adjourned.
